A rotary tool is a hand held tool that contains several rotating accessories and bits that can be very useful for cutting, carving, polishing and sanding. The handheld feature allows for safer and more accurate handling as compared to higher powered tools.

Rotary Broaching is a method of producing both internal and external forms fast and accurately on the end of a workpiece. Rotary broaching makes it possible to very accurate forms within 0.0005 inches within seconds. With rotary broaching not only can you produce standard shapes such as hexagons and squares but also shapes such as Double Hex Rotary Broaches, 6-Lobe Rotary Broaches, Serration Rotary Broaches, J500 Rotary Broaches, Spline Rotary Broaches, Involute Rotary Broaches, Torx Rotary Broaches, Double D Rotary Broaches and any other Special Design Required. Rotary broaches can be made to just about any size, English or Metric. Some of the material that can be rotary broached is brass, aluminum and steel and can go as much as 2 inches deep.

Rotary broaching tools are used to precision cut internal polygon forms. This method is becoming very popular and has made appearances in the medical, automotive, aerospace, and plumbing fields.

The basic categories of cutting tools are linear and rotary machines. Linear cutting tools include tool bits and broaches. Rotary cutting tools include drill bits, countersinks and counterbores, taps and dies, milling cutters, reamers, and cold saw blades.
